About The Position

Information Security Risk Analyst The Opportunity: Work with the DoD to identify their cyber risks, comprehend relevant policies , and develop mitigation strategies. Gather technical, environmental, and personnel information from SMEs to assess the DoD threat landscape. Establish t rus ted relationships with clients and provide expert advice to help solve their problems. Act in an advisory capacity to ensure clients operate securely within an evolving IT environment. Develop solutions and actively e nga ge in information security while enhancing your skills in IT and cloud computing. You Have: 4+ years of experience in cybersecurity Experience with security assessments and audits, including vulnerability scanning Experience in incident response and handling security breaches Experience with cybersecurity frameworks Knowledge of information security in IT threats, attacks, and vulnerabilities Knowledge of the DoD Risk Management Framework ( RMF ) and Authority to Operate ( ATO ) processes Ability to stay current with emerging cybersecurity threats and technologies Active TS/SCI clearance; willingness to take a polygraph exam Asso cia te's degree DoD 8140 IAT Level II Certification Nice If You Have: Experience with the U.S. military and DoD IT environments and regulatory compliance requirements Experience creating and managing security documentation such as System Security Plans ( SSPs ) and Plan of Action and Milestones ( POA & Ms ) Experience applying abstract security requirements such as NIST 800-53 controls to information systems Experience with System Information and Event Management ( SIEM ) tools Experience with eMASS or XACTA and with Agile processes Knowledge of enterprise environments and cloud architecture, including AWS or Azure Knowledge of Vulnerability Management, Configuration Management, and Data Management Knowledge of Windows or Linux systems Possession of excellent anal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ills to identify security risks, develop appropriate mitigation strategies, and effectively convey security concepts to both technical and non-technical stakeholders Bachelor’s degree Clearance: Applicants selected will be subject to a security investigation and may need to meet eligibility requirements for access to classified information ; TS/SCI clearance is required.
